Maximilian Wilhelm max

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 9f31c06285 dhcp-server: Clean up white spaces in templates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

1 week 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• bd9b0bc5ca unattended-upgrades: Add config for Debian Boorkworm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

1 week 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• a021074e44 install-server: Add preseed for Debian Bookworm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

1 week 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• a80743e478 install-server: Support multiple Debian releases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

1 week 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 89247b5720 dhcp-server: Use input from dhcp_server NACL module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• 79c2e08b00 icinga2: Only write secrets on icinga server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• defff3a255 icinga2: Remove old ldap_replication check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• View comparison for these 3 commits »

1 week ago

max pushed to master at FreifunkHochstift/ffho-salt-public

2 months ago

max pushed to master at FreifunkHochstift/ffho-firmware-website

  • 33dd602392 sign stable 1.6.0 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

2 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 3774498fb5 prometheus: Only scrape active nodes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

2 months ago

max pushed to master at FreifunkHochstift/ffho-firmware-website

  • 76101c63b2 Sign 1.6.0~rc1 testing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

3 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 7d4237732d icinga2: Apply the ssl_host_cert fix for > Debian 10 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• 54cdaf4438 locales: Add new config file for Debian Bookworm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• aff112a215 postfix: Use Debian Bullseye's config as standard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• a6f75e13fc ssh: Add sshd_config for Debian Bookworm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• 51cb518159 sysctl: Use Debian Bullseye's values as default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• View comparison for these 8 commits »

3 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 3fa8a70532 yanic: Migrate ff_merge_nodes_json to Python3 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

3 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

4 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• a1ebdff8f7 install-server: Update first-boot script * Explicitly state that key has been accepted on master * Back up SSH keys, just in case * Show IP addresses of the system, to SSH into it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

5 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• fc3ff96343 install-server: Also install salt-minion, screen, and vim. On systems not installed via preseed these packages aren't automatically present, so make sure they are when we start the ZTP process.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

5 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 8620f9d1f5 SDN: Assume IPv6 LLA VTEPs if no IPs configured on underlay The exist code generating VTEP interface configurations already distinguishes between IPv4 and IPv6 Multicast VTEP IPs based on the existance of any IP set on the underlay interface. If at least one IP address is configured, IPv4 is used, whereas if no IP address is configured, IPv6 LLA is used. This way the original design choice for dual-use underlays, Dual Stack IP Routing + BATMAN overlay, still is easily supported.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

5 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 04f0825b4d SDN: Rework B.A.T.M.A.N. Adv. interface penalties to reflect DCIs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

5 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 1a19d899a6 SDN: VXLANoIPv6 needs 20b more head room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

5 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 04c0a84aa3 unattended-upgrades: Only send an email on errors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

5 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 351677e136 Take DHCP out of highstate for now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• 37900e4c97 yanic: Make sure webserver is only activated on the 1st instance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• 29b2c1fba9 DNS: Update and activate base-line DNS generator based on NetBox data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• ca77ffe4f8 Move cmp() func into ffho module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>
  • View comparison for these 4 commits »

9 months ago

max pushed to master at FreifunkHochstift/ffho-salt-public

  • 7ad21ce3b5 prometheus-server: Only target node_exporter for Linux nodes Signed-off-by: Maximilian Wilhelm <max@sdn.clinic>

9 months ago